summaryrefslogtreecommitdiffstats
path: root/base/kernel/Pkgfile
diff options
context:
space:
mode:
Diffstat (limited to 'base/kernel/Pkgfile')
-rw-r--r--base/kernel/Pkgfile11
1 files changed, 5 insertions, 6 deletions
diff --git a/base/kernel/Pkgfile b/base/kernel/Pkgfile
index 77355ff91..4f492f607 100644
--- a/base/kernel/Pkgfile
+++ b/base/kernel/Pkgfile
@@ -6,15 +6,10 @@
name=kernel
version=2.6.30.5
-release=1
+release=2
source=(http://www.kernel.org/pub/linux/kernel/v2.6/linux-${version}.tar.bz2\
config_64 config)
build(){
-
-rm -rf /usr/src/kernel
-mkdir /usr/src/kernel
-mv linux-${version} /usr/src/kernel/
-ln -svf /usr/src/kernel/linux-${version}
cd linux-$version
make mrproper
case `uname -m` in
@@ -46,4 +41,8 @@ case `uname -m` in
ln -sf kernel-$version \
$PKG/boot/kernel;;
esac
+cd $PKG/lib/modules/$version/
+rm {build,source}
+ln -sv /usr/src/linux-$version build
+ln -sv /usr/src/linux-$version source
}